About Le ROI
le roi hotels resorts is a renowned name in the hotel industry offering laudable services and opulent accommodation to guests. le roi hotels and resorts has three properties in new d... Read more
le roi hotels resorts is a renowned name in the hotel industry offering laudable services and opulent accommodation to guests. le roi hotels and resorts has three properties in new d... Read more